How to Sow and Plant

Soil: Prepare rich, well-drained soil with organic matter.
Sowing: Sow seeds lightly on the surface and press in; hosta seeds need light for germination.
Water: Keep consistently moist (not waterlogged) until seedlings emerge.
Light: Provide partial to full shade for best foliage color and growth.
Spacing: Transplant seedlings once established, spacing plants 18–36 inches apart for mature clumps.

How to Grow

Light: Partial to full shade — direct hot sun can fade leaf color.
Water: Moderate watering; soil should remain moist but not soggy.
Soil: Moist, slightly acidic to neutral, rich in organic matter.
Mulching: Apply mulch to retain moisture and suppress weeds.
Maintenance: Remove old foliage in late fall; divide mature clumps every few years to maintain vigor.

Tips

Hostas pair beautifully with ferns, astilbes, and shade perennials for layered shade garden plantings.
Protect plants from slugs and snail pests with organic deterrents.

Blue Hosta (Hosta sieboldiana and related hybrids) are classic perennial foliage plants treasured for their striking blue-toned leaves and shade tolerance. These ornamental plants spread in clumps that form lush garden borders and shaded beds. Perfect for low-light areas under trees, along walkways, and in landscape plantings, hostas are easy to grow and require minimal maintenance once established. Their soft blue hues create contrast with other garden plants, enhancing visual depth and texture in outdoor garden settings.
